The main functions of rutin extracted from Sophora japonica buds are as follows:
Rutin is a natural antioxidant that can scavenge excessive free radicals in the body, such as superoxide anion radicals and hydroxyl radicals. These free radicals can damage cell membranes, proteins, and nucleic acids, leading to a variety of diseases, including those related to aging. Rutin protects cells from oxidative stress by providing hydrogen atoms to neutralize free radicals. For example, in some in - vitro cell experiments, the addition of rutin can significantly reduce cell damage induced by oxidative stress and increase cell survival rate.
- Reducing capillary permeability and fragility: Rutin can enhance the resistance of capillaries and maintain their normal permeability. This helps prevent capillary rupture and bleeding and is effective in preventing and improving diseases caused by fragile capillaries, such as purpura.
- Antithrombotic effect: It can inhibit platelet aggregation and reduce the risk of thrombosis. Platelet aggregation is a crucial step in thrombosis, and rutin exerts its antithrombotic effect by inhibiting the relevant signaling pathways and reducing platelet activity.
- Antihypertensive effect: Rutin can dilate blood vessels and reduce peripheral vascular resistance, thereby lowering blood pressure. Some animal experiments have shown that rutin can reduce the blood pressure of hypertensive model animals to varying degrees.
Rutin can inhibit the release of inflammatory factors such as interleukin - 1β (IL - 1β), interleukin - 6 (IL - 6), and tumor necrosis factor - α (TNF - α). These inflammatory factors play a key role in the inflammatory response. By inhibiting their release, rutin can alleviate the inflammatory response. In some inflammatory disease models, such as arthritis models, rutin can reduce joint swelling and pain and improve inflammatory symptoms.
Although rutin cannot directly serve as an anti - tumor drug, it can play an adjuvant role in tumor treatment. It can enhance the body's immunity and improve the body's immune surveillance ability against tumor cells. At the same time, the antioxidant effect of rutin also helps to reduce the damage to normal tissues during chemotherapy and radiotherapy. For example, in some in - vitro experiments of tumor cells, the combination of rutin and chemotherapy drugs can improve the killing effect of chemotherapy drugs on tumor cells and reduce the toxicity of chemotherapy drugs to normal cells.
Rutin can protect liver cells from damage and promote the regeneration of liver cells. It can reduce oxidative stress and inflammatory response in the liver and has a certain improvement effect on some liver diseases, such as drug - induced liver injury and fatty liver. Research has found that rutin can regulate the activities of some enzymes in the liver, such as glutathione peroxidase (GSH - Px) and superoxide dismutase (SOD), and enhance the antioxidant capacity of the liver.
